Browser Control lets AI agents operate the user's real Chrome browser locally.
It runs a localhost daemon that talks to a Chrome Manifest V3 extension over WebSocket. Through that bridge, agents can navigate pages, inspect the DOM, click, fill forms, capture screenshots and downloads, and inspect network requests while keeping browser automation traffic on the local machine.
AI Agent -> Browser Control skill scripts -> localhost HTTP daemon -> WebSocket -> Chrome extension -> Chrome DOM
The published Skill lives in skills/browser-control/. That directory is self-contained: it includes the agent-facing SKILL.md, command-line scripts, reference docs, a loadable Chrome extension build, and the vendored WebSocket runtime needed by the daemon.
- Navigate, inspect, and operate real Chrome tabs.
- Read DOM snapshots and visible page text.
- Click, fill, press keys, select options, and toggle controls.
- Capture screenshots, PDFs, downloads, and other local artifacts.
- Inspect network requests from the active browser session.
- Reuse logged-in Chrome sessions while keeping all traffic on localhost.

Commands are sent to POST /command as typed envelopes:
{
"id": "req-1",
"version": "2026-05-19",
"session": "demo",
"command": "navigate",
"args": { "url": "https://example.com" },
"timeoutMs": 30000
}Supported browser commands include navigate, find_tab, snapshot, get_text, scroll, click, click_probe, fill, press, select_option, set_checked, wait_for, evaluate, screenshot, save_as_pdf, observe_start, observe_diff, network_start, network_list, network_detail, network_stop, upload, download, list_tabs, close_tab, and close_session.

Browser Control is intentionally localhost-only by default. The daemon listens on 127.0.0.1, the extension connects to the local daemon WebSocket, and artifacts are written to the user's local machine.
Because Browser Control automates a real browser, the Chrome extension requests permissions to access pages, manage downloads, capture screenshots, and use debugger-backed browser operations. Agents should still ask before risky actions such as submitting forms, changing account settings, uploading local files, handling credentials, making purchases, or performing destructive operations. The Skill instructions define those confirmation boundaries in skills/browser-control/SKILL.md.
Snapshot and observation commands redact likely sensitive field values such as password, token, cookie, session, and API-key-like fields.
